1.(a) Energy is the ability or capacity to do work.
(1 mark)
1.(b) Uses of Energy
- Energy is used to operate machines.
- Energy from food enables us to walk, read and play.
- Used for effective communication.
- Light energy provides visibility.
- Used at home to watch television, charge our phones, and listen to radio.
- Used in banks, hospitals, schools, and markets to do various activities.
- Helps to maintain security by arm forces.
- Used for our daily activities.
(Any four at 1 mark each = 4 marks)
